#4b974d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b974d is composed of 29.4% red, 59.2%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 49%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 121.6 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 44.3%. #4b974d color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ff9a with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#4b974d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b974d has RGB values of R:75, G:151,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 4953933.

Shades and Tints of #4b974d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030703 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b974d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e746e is the less saturated color, while #05dd0b is the most saturated one.
